(<a href=\"https:\/\/wgntv.com\/sports\/bears-report\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:WGN;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">WGN<\/a>) \u2014 Caleb Williams is hungry and taking every opportunity to learn Ben Johnson\u2019s offense. The Chicago Bears\u2019 head coach is chewing players out for mistakes, while praising others for their success\u2014something veterans have eaten up. Not much is wrong in the land of Bears, except for one thing.<\/p>\n<p>Advertisement<\/p>\n<p>Their top two draft picks haven\u2019t seen much of the field this offseason.<\/p>\n<p>Chicago\u2019s first-round pick and the tenth overall selection in this year\u2019s draft, Colston Loveland, was seen catching passes and running routes with a helmet on for the first time during minicamp or OTAs Tuesday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"\"><a class=\"link  yahoo-link\" href=\"https:\/\/sports.yahoo.com\/article\/caleb-williams-embraces-opportunity-extra-234822641.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:Caleb Williams embraces opportunity for extra reps at Bears last voluntary OTAs;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as;outcm:mb_qualified_link;_E:mb_qualified_link;ct:story;\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\"> Caleb Williams embraces opportunity for extra reps at Bears last voluntary OTAs <\/a><\/p>\n<p>The former Michigan Wolverine has recovered enough from an AC joint injury that required surgery to do everything but (maybe) throw a football with his right arm.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I\u2019ve become ambidextrous, kind of,\u201d Loveland said with a laugh after practice.<\/p>\n<p>Advertisement<\/p>\n<p>Outside of the action on the practice fields at Halas Hall, Loveland said he\u2019s also back to lifting weights as a part of the Bears\u2019 offseason training program, but Johnson wouldn\u2019t commit to whether his prized rookie tight end will be fully ready to go once training camp rolls around in mid-late July.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cTo be honest with you, I haven\u2019t even looked that far ahead,\u201d Johnson said. \u201cWe will get that before we officially break for summer, just the expectation for camp and who\u2019s going to be full-go day one, and who is still limited and working in. I don\u2019t have that answer for you at this moment.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Loveland, as can be expected, was a little more optimistic about his chances than his head coach, but he\u2019s still taking things one day at a time with a certain set of goals in mind.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cJust work. Get back right, continue rehab. I\u2019m working out,\u201d Loveland said. \u201cBut, [I] definitely have my own little walkthroughs, whether I need to go with my brother or whoever that is, saying some plays, lining up, just doing stuff repetitively [and] getting those reps so that it just becomes second-nature at that point. That\u2019s the goal.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Advertisement<\/p>\n<p>If he checks all the boxes he\u2019s identified, he thinks he\u2019ll be ready for day 1 of training camp.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That\u2019s the plan. Just working every day to get there,\u201d Loveland said.<\/p>\n<p>As for the Bears\u2019 first pick in the second round, Luther Burden III, he\u2019s seen the practice field only a handful more times than Loveland this offseason.<\/p>\n<p>Burden suffered what Johnson called a \u201csoft tissue injury\u201d during rookie minicamp that led to him being unavailable during the portions of minicamp and offseason OTAs made available to local media.<\/p>\n<p>Chicago\u2019s rookie head coach isn\u2019t concerned about Burden\u2019s long-term future though when it comes to that soft tissue injury. He expects him to be a full go once training camp rolls around.<\/p>\n<p>Advertisement<\/p>\n<p>What Johnson is more concerned about is the reps rookies like Burden and Loveland are missing due to their injuries.<\/p>\n<p>\u201c[Burden] misses a lot. Any time you\u2019re not out there, if you\u2019re in the training room when the rest of the guys are practicing, you\u2019re losing valuable time\u2014valuable time with your coaches, valuable reps with your teammates, the ability to build the trust that we\u2019re talking about,\u201d Johnson said. \u201cIt\u2019s not just the coaching staff having trust in you, doing the right thing over and over, but it\u2019s also your teammates.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They have to be out there. They have to see you do it. They have to know that the guy to the right and the left of them are going to do the right things, and they\u2019re going to make the plays when called upon. It\u2019s for everybody. It\u2019s a shame that he got dinged up and missed all that time, because for a young player, it\u2019s really where you get the most reps and you can get better in a hurry that way. That\u2019s really for every player on this team.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Copyright 2025 Nexstar Media, Inc. All rights reserved.
